The articles below in leading newspapers provide details about the Power Tariff hike in Karnataka effective 01-May-2012.

A new concept of 'Day Tariff' has also been introduced where in using digital meters, based on peak hours charges at higher tariff than compared to lean hours at night.

This is the key feature of the the Karnataka Energy Regulatory Commission's Time of Day (TOD) metering scheme which has been run on a pilot basis for three years with 50 industries.

"This will give all industrial consumers an option to come to a consensus on shifting their peak loads to night. Most have digitized meters which indicate consumption levels every hour," said MR Sreenivasa Murthy, chairman, KERC.

However, industry bodies feel they're being burdened doubly. "Firstly, the tariff order is untimely ; it is the third time there has been a hike in the past two financial years. The tariff hike for HT2A consumers is Rs 1.10 per KWH, about 27% increase. For LT industrial consumers , it is 90 paise per KWH, about 25% increase. This makes industrial operations unviable," said JR Bangera, president, Federation of Karnataka Chamber of Commerce and Industries (FKCCI).

Energy Conservation - A better alternative to production?
Traditionally the way of reducing energy dependence has been to generate energy using non-conventional means like Solar Power, Solar water heating, Alternate Fuels, etc. However, except for a few clean technologies which have high initial costs and low rate of ROI, some of the energy generation technologies add to the carbon footprints. Alternate fuels, though reducing dependence on Petroleum, do generate carbon in the process of converting fuel into energy. Then there is also a recurring cost on such fuels as well.

So what is the other way of looking at it? Conserving Wasted Energy is a big and clean way to reduce carbon foot-prints due to reduced consumption, rather than completely depending on more energy generation all the time.

Saving on wasted energy is something that is yet to catch on as a concept in India. In many western countries, several government level programs started decades ago have started to yield dividends today across the country.

As an afterthought, we want to leave you with this simple case study:
about more than a decade ago, the US government started an 'Energy Star' (Website link) program which specifically targeted energy wasted by computer monitors when left idle through the night or when nobody is using the computers. From this initiative was born the concept of monitors going to sleep when left idle for a long time and saving on a lot of energy! Today this simple but innovative features helps save several megawatts of power around the world and it is a de-facto feature in almost all computer monitors produced today.
